La Bazouge-de-Chemeré
La Bazouge-de-Chemeré (; also La Bazouge-de-Chémeré) is a commune in the Mayenne department in northwestern France. Geography The village stands on a promontory above the Vaige river. On the opposite side there are limestone quarries and old lime kilns. The village stands at the far east of the Armorican Massif so the geology presents various facies : limestone, coal, rhyolite, slate, slate shale. There were anthracite mines dedicated to the lime kiln. The lime was used for liming (soil) until 1896 when chemical fertilizers have been available, so the lime kilns has stopped and also the mining because coal layers are not regular but spread in distant columns. History In 1926 the lightning torched the bell tower then the church. The steeple cover has been built again shorter and the bells were cast again then baptized in 1930. Mayenne
Mayenne ( ) is a landlocked department in northwest France named after the river Mayenne. Mayenne is part of the administrative region of Pays de la Loire and is surrounded by the departments of Manche, Orne, Sarthe, Maine-et-Loire, and Ille-et-Vilaine. Mayenne is one of the original 83 departments created during the French Revolution on 4 March 1790. The northern two thirds correspond to the western part of the former province of Maine. The southern third of Mayenne corresponds to the northern portion of the old province of Anjou. The inhabitants of the department are called ''Mayennais''. Departments Of France
In the administrative divisions of France, the department (, ) is one of the three levels of government under the national level ("territorial collectivity, territorial collectivities"), between the Regions of France, administrative regions and the Communes of France, communes. There are a total of 101 departments, consisting of ninety-six departments in metropolitan France, and five Overseas department and region, overseas departments, which are also classified as overseas regions. Departments are further subdivided into 333 Arrondissements of France, arrondissements and 2,054 Cantons of France, cantons (as of 2023). These last two levels of government have no political autonomy, instead serving as the administrative basis for the local organisation of police, fire departments, and, in certain cases, elections. Limestone
Limestone is a type of carbonate rock, carbonate sedimentary rock which is the main source of the material Lime (material), lime. It is composed mostly of the minerals calcite and aragonite, which are different Polymorphism (materials science), crystal forms of calcium carbonate . Limestone forms when these minerals Precipitation (chemistry), precipitate out of water containing dissolved calcium. This can take place through both biological and nonbiological processes, though biological processes, such as the accumulation of corals and shells in the sea, have likely been more important for the last 540 million years. Limestone often contains fossils which provide scientists with information on ancient environments and on the evolution of life. About 20% to 25% of sedimentary rock is carbonate rock, and most of this is limestone. Lime Kiln
A lime kiln is a kiln used for the calcination of limestone (calcium carbonate) to produce the form of lime called ''quicklime'' (calcium oxide). The chemical equation for this reaction is: CaCO3 + heat → CaO + CO2 This reaction can take place at anywhere above , but is generally considered to occur at (at which temperature the partial pressure of CO2 is 1 atmosphere), but a temperature around (at which temperature the partial pressure of CO2 is 3.8 atmospheres) is usually used to make the reaction proceed quickly.Parkes, G.D. and Mellor, J.W. (1939). ''Mellor's Modern Inorganic Chemistry'' London: Longmans, Green and Co. Excessive temperature is avoided because it produces unreactive, "dead-burned" lime. Slaked lime (calcium hydroxide) can be formed by mixing quicklime with water. Armorican Massif
The Armorican Massif (, ) is a geologic massif that covers a large area in the northwest of France, including Brittany, the western part of Normandy and the Pays de la Loire. It is important because it is connected to Dover on the British side of the English Channel and there has been tilting back and forth that has controlled the geography on both sides. Its name comes from the old Armorica, a Gauls, Gaul area between the rivers Loire and Seine. The massif is composed of metamorphic rock, metamorphic and magmatic rocks that were metamorphism, metamorphosed and/or Deformation (geology), deformed during the Variscan orogeny, Hercynian or Variscan orogeny (400 to 280 million years ago) and the earlier Cadomian orogeny (650 to 550 million years ago). The region was tectonic uplift, uplifted when the Bay of Biscay opened during the Cretaceous period (geology), period. Rhyolite
Rhyolite ( ) is the most silica-rich of volcanic rocks. It is generally glassy or fine-grained (aphanitic) in texture (geology), texture, but may be porphyritic, containing larger mineral crystals (phenocrysts) in an otherwise fine-grained matrix (geology), groundmass. The mineral assemblage is predominantly quartz, sanidine, and plagioclase. It is the extrusive equivalent of granite. Its high silica content makes rhyolitic magma extremely viscosity, viscous. This favors explosive eruptions over effusive eruptions, so this type of magma is more often erupted as pyroclastic rock than as lava flows. Rhyolitic ash-flow tuffs are among the most voluminous of continental igneous rock formations. Rhyolitic tuff has been used extensively for construction. Obsidian, which is rhyolitic volcanic glass, has been used for tools from prehistoric times to the present day because it can be shaped to an extremely sharp edge. Anthracite
Anthracite, also known as hard coal and black coal, is a hard, compact variety of coal that has a lustre (mineralogy)#Submetallic lustre, submetallic lustre. It has the highest carbon content, the fewest impurities, and the highest energy density of all types of coal and is the highest Coal analysis#Coal classification by rank, ranking of coals. The Coal Region of Northeastern Pennsylvania in the United States has the largest known deposits of anthracite coal in the world with an estimated reserve of seven billion short ton, short tons. Coal in China, China accounts for the majority of global production; other producers include Coal in Russia, Russia, Coal in Ukraine, Ukraine, Coal in North Korea, North Korea, Coal in South Africa, South Africa, Coal in Vietnam, Vietnam, Coal in Australia, Australia, Coal in Canada, Canada, and the Coal mining in the United States, United States. Liming (soil)
Liming is the application of calcium- (Ca) and magnesium (Mg)-rich materials in various forms, including marl, chalk, limestone, burnt lime or hydrated lime to soil. In acid soils, these materials react as a base and neutralize soil acidity. This often improves plant growth and increases the activity of soil bacteria, but oversupply may result in harm to plant life. Modern liming was preceded by marling, a process of spreading raw chalk and lime debris across soil, in an attempt to modify pH or aggregate size. Evidence of these practices dates to the 1200's and the earliest examples are taken from the modern British Isles. Impact on soil properties Liming can also improve aggregate stability on clay soils. For this purpose structure lime, products containing calcium oxide (CaO) or hydroxide (Ca(OH)2) in mixes with calcium carbonate (CaCO3), are often used. Ultralight Aviation
Ultralight aviation (called microlight aviation in some countries) is the flying of lightweight, 1- or 2-seat fixed-wing aircraft. Some countries differentiate between weight-shift control and Aircraft flight control system, conventional three-axis control aircraft with ailerons, Elevator (aircraft), elevator and Rudder#Aircraft rudders, rudder, calling the former "microlight" and the latter "ultralight". During the late 1970s and early 1980s, mostly stimulated by the hang gliding movement, many people sought affordable powered flight. As a result, many aviation authorities set up definitions of lightweight, slow-flying aeroplanes that could be subject to minimum regulations. The resulting aeroplanes are commonly called "ultralight aircraft" or "microlights", although the weight and speed limits differ from country to country.
